> Plex has been saying for months now they were going to discontinue 
> plugins, and I regularly use some.  The latest version, 1.16.5, has 
> discontinued plugin support.  (You can still see the plugin icons, but they 
> no longer function.)  Staying on or reverting to 1.15.x will allow you to 
> continue using plugins.
